Output 3dfd37dac0dfd531dc5eb951394def4d737d13f46053e11d2ea71d51d3bb0e66:0

value
1068595
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e72e7655fe0ae8444538643702d8ff067dd486e OP_EQUAL
address
37PDU6j3a8G731VSeJaLLvdRbhfGE42nnQ
transaction
3dfd37dac0dfd531dc5eb951394def4d737d13f46053e11d2ea71d51d3bb0e66
confirmations
313210
spent
true